May 7 - 13 Joyful Spirit

The team divided in two with half of them spending the week assisting at Little Children of Jesus. While Julie did physiotherapy the others helped with feeding, bathing and led play activities with the kids.  The “construction” side of the gang, completed the school incinerator project and put a roof over the latrine for the secondary building.
